Limestone Characteristics, Formation, Texture, Uses,Facts

2023年5月23日  limestone, sedimentary rock composed mainly of calcium carbonate (CaCO 3 ), usually in the form of calcite or aragonite. It may contain considerable amounts of magnesium carbonate (dolomite) as well; minor constituents also commonly present include clay, iron carbonate, feldspar, pyrite, and quartz. sandstone: laminated

Chalk rock Britannica

chalk, soft, fine-grained, easily pulverized, white-to-grayish variety of limestone. Chalk is composed of the shells of such minute marine organisms as foraminifera, coccoliths, and rhabdoliths. The purest varieties contain up to 99 percent calcium carbonate in the form of the mineral calcite. The sponge spicules, diatom and radiolarian tests (shells), detrital

Calcium Carbonate (CaCO3) Structure, Properties, Uses

2023年6月23日  It is a water-insoluble source of calcium. It is mainly found in rocks and is the carbonic salt of calcium. Some of the pure calcium carbonate minerals are Calcite, Vaterite, Aragonite. Biological sources of calcium carbonate are Snail shells, Eggshells, Oyster shells etc. Mostly used as an antacid or calcium supplement. PH value is about 9.91.

CHAPTER 2 MINERAL INDUSTRY EMISSIONS IGES

2006年10月23日  The primary process resulting in the release of CO2 is the calcination of carbonate compounds, during which, through heating, a metallic oxide is formed. A typical calcination reaction, here shown for the mineral calcite or calcium carbonate, would be: CaCO3 + heat Æ CaO + CO2 Acid-induced release of CO2, for example, via an equation
